Leveraging National Broadcast Partners

While the YES Network handles the majority of the slate, the Yankees appear on several national networks that offer their own streaming solutions. Games broadcast on networks such as Fox, ESPN, and TBS are often available through the network’s own apps or via authentication through your cable provider. This is where the yankees streaming schedule intersects with the broader MLB broadcast calendar, as these national games are strategically placed on marquee days, including rivalry series and holiday matchups.

To view these specific matchups, fans must navigate the authentication process correctly. Services like Hulu + Live TV, YouTube TV, and DirecTV Stream typically carry these networks and allow for seamless streaming on various devices. The advantage here is stability; these platforms offer robust apps that integrate DVR functionality, allowing you to watch the game on your own schedule without sacrificing the live experience if you have a conflicting commitment.

Decoding Blackout Restrictions and Geolocation

One of the most frustrating aspects of streaming any professional sport is encountering a blackout, and the Yankees are no exception. The league enforces strict territorial rights to protect local broadcasters, which means games may be unavailable in certain zip codes or states. Understanding the geography of these restrictions is vital for planning your viewing, as a game might be accessible in Manhattan but blocked in neighboring New Jersey depending on the broadcast window.

The Role of MLB.TV and Out-of-Market Flexibility

For fans living far outside the Yankees' designated broadcast region, MLB.TV is the undisputed champion of access. This league-wide service offers out-of-market streaming of every regular season game, allowing a fan in California to watch the Bronx Bombers with the same clarity as one in the Bronx.
